PPG Industries (NYSE:PPG) First Quarter Earnings Show Decline In Sales And Income
Reviewed by Simply Wall St
PPG Industries (NYSE:PPG) reported a 2% rise in share price over the last week, amidst a backdrop of declining sales and earnings. The company announced a year-over-year decrease in first-quarter sales to USD 3,684 million, with net income also falling to USD 373 million. Despite this, PPG's shares moved in a positive direction, possibly aligning with broader market trends that saw a 5.2% increase over the same period. While the challenging financial metrics might have added weight to the current market sentiment, they did not seem to counter the overall upward movement in the market.

The recent increase in PPG Industries' share price, despite a decline in sales and earnings, might reflect broader market trends rather than company-specific strengths. The company's strategic divestitures and cost reduction measures aim to enhance operational margins and drive sustainable growth, particularly in Aerospace Coatings and other segments. However, weak European market conditions and currency issues could dampen these efforts, impacting future revenue and earnings forecasts.
Over the longer term, PPG's shares achieved a total return of 29.01% over the past five years, highlighting consistent performance amid fluctuations. This places its return above the more recent 9.9% annual performance of the broader US market, despite underperformance against the US Chemicals industry over the past year. The current share price, at US$101.78, trails the analyst consensus price target of US$125.70 by 19.0%, indicating potential upside if PPG can meet future growth expectations.
